module Data.Geospatial.Geometry.GeoMultiPolygon (
-- * Type
GeoMultiPolygon(..)
-- * Lenses
, unGeoMultiPolygon
-- * To Polygons
, splitGeoMultiPolygon, mergeGeoPolygons
) where
import Data.Geospatial.BasicTypes
import Data.Geospatial.Geometry.GeoPolygon
import Data.Geospatial.Geometry.Aeson
import Data.LinearRing
import Control.Lens ( makeLenses )
import Control.Monad ( mzero )
import Data.Aeson ( FromJSON(..), ToJSON(..), Value(..), Object )
newtype GeoMultiPolygon = GeoMultiPolygon { _unGeoMultiPolygon :: [[LinearRing GeoPositionWithoutCRS]] } deriving (Show, Eq)
-- | Split GeoMultiPolygon coordinates into multiple GeoPolygons
splitGeoMultiPolygon :: GeoMultiPolygon -> [GeoPolygon]
splitGeoMultiPolygon = map GeoPolygon . _unGeoMultiPolygon
-- | Merge multiple GeoPolygons into one GeoMultiPolygon
mergeGeoPolygons :: [GeoPolygon] -> GeoMultiPolygon
mergeGeoPolygons = GeoMultiPolygon . map _unGeoPolygon
makeLenses ''GeoMultiPolygon
-- instances
instance ToJSON GeoMultiPolygon where
-- toJSON :: a -> Value
toJSON = makeGeometryGeoAeson "MultiPolygon" . _unGeoMultiPolygon
instance FromJSON GeoMultiPolygon where
-- parseJSON :: Value -> Parser a
parseJSON (Object o) = readGeometryGeoAeson "MultiPolygon" GeoMultiPolygon o
parseJSON _ = mzero
